摘要
目的:研究宁夏汉族大学生指长波动性不对称(FA)与握力(HGS)的关系。方法:采用体质测量法,比较宁夏汉族大学生630例(男性232例,女性398例)示指、中指、环指、小指指长FA(2FA、3FA、4FA、5FA)、复合FA(CFA)及握力均值的差异性,分析2FA、4FA与握力的关系。结果:宁夏汉族大学生女性各指FA及握力均值低于男性,且2FA、4FA、CFA及握力差异有统计学意义;女性2FA和4FA人数在|L-R|≥0.04组显著低于男性;女性2FA和男性4FA与右手握力明显相关。结论:指长FA及握力有性别差异,2FA和4FA与握力相关,可能是个体某些运动潜能的间接生物学参考指标之一。
Objective:To investigate the relationship between fluctuating asymmetry(FA)of digit length and handgrip strength(HGS)in college students of Han ethnicity from Ningxia.Methods:Using anthropometry,the mean values of 2 FA,3 FA,4 FA,5 FA,composite FA(CFA)and HGS of 630(males:232;females:398)college students of Han ethnicity were compared,and the relationship between 2 FA,4 FA and HGS were studied.Results:FA of each digit and HGS were lower in females than those in males.Significant differences of 2 FA,4 FA,CFA and HGS were found between different genders.Compared with males,the distribution of 2 FA and 4 FA in|L-R|≥0.04 group were lower in females.2 FA significantly correlated with HGS in females while 4 FA significantly correlated with HGS in males on the right hand.Conclusion:FA and HGS have gender difference.The 2 FA and 4 FA are correlated with HGS,which may be one of the indirect reference biomarkers for some potential exercise.
